According to the research report, "Italy Smart Poles Market Overview, 2031," published by Bonafide Research, the Italy Smart Poles market is expected to reach a market size of USD 699.80 Million by 2031.Italy's smart pole market has undergone a remarkable transformation over the past five years, evolving from fragmented LED retrofits into a coordinated national infrastructure priority. The sector is propelled by a powerful convergence of European funding and municipal ambition.
• The European Investment Bank (EIB) granted INWIT €350 million in February 2025 to boost digitalisation and connectivity across Italy, with investments planned for outdoor small cells and multi-operator Distributed Antenna Systems (DAS) to improve mobile coverage in hospitals, museums, shopping centres, underground lines, and motorway tunnels.
• The National Recovery and Resilience Plan (PNRR) has further accelerated deployment, with Italy's smart city market surpassing €1 billion in 2025. Brescia became the first Italian city to integrate EV charging directly into public lighting poles, with A2A installing eight "City Plug Lamp" poles featuring 16 charging points near the Brescia Due metro station. Beinasco is advancing the RESONANCE project, co-financed by the Interreg Europe 2021-2027 programme, to transform its urban lighting and traffic management network into intelligent infrastructure through multifunctional smart poles.

Competitive Landscape of Italy Smart Pole Market


• A dynamic and competitive ecosystem characterizes Italy's smart pole market, blending global energy giants with specialized infrastructure innovators. Leading participants include Enel X (Enel Group's global business line for energy transition), A2A, INWIT (Italy's leading tower company), Siemens AG, and Schneider Electric SE.
• Enel X has reaffirmed its strong expertise in developing smart lighting technologies while recognising the challenges that remain in achieving optimal energy efficiency and system performance. The value chain is shifting toward integrated solutions, as demonstrated by A2A's City Plug Lamp project, where street poles become multifunctional hubs housing EV charging, 5G connectivity modules, and video surveillance devices.
• Investment is flowing through multiple channels, with the EIB's €350 million financing supporting both macro-grid and micro-grid telecommunications infrastructure, including small cells that can be hosted on smart poles.
• Municipalities are increasingly procuring performance-based contracts, with Beinasco's RESONANCE project representing a €1.89 million investment (€1.49 million ERDF contribution) spanning May 2025 to July 2029. Consumer expectations are evolving, with citizens demanding tangible benefits including improved public safety, real-time environmental monitoring, and EV charging accessibility.

Italy Market Dynamics



Driver: European Investment Bank and PNRR Funding
The EIB's €350 million financing agreement with INWIT, signed in February 2025, represents a transformative catalyst for Italy's smart pole market. Combined with PNRR allocations for public lighting efficiency and smart city infrastructure, this funding enables municipalities to overcome the high initial capital expenditure that traditionally hampers adoption. The financing supports macro-grid telecommunications infrastructure and outdoor small cells, creating natural synergies with smart pole deployment.

Challenge: Fragmented Municipal Procurement and Legacy Infrastructure
Italy's highly decentralised municipal governance structure creates significant deployment friction. Each of the country's nearly 8,000 municipalities maintains independent procurement processes and technical standards, leading to inconsistent deployment quality and delayed project timelines. The complexity of retrofitting Italy's extensive legacy lighting infrastructure further increases costs and extends project timelines, as evidenced by Monza's journey from 16% failure rates in 2023 to 3.40% in 2025.

Trend: AI-Powered Adaptive Lighting and Sound Sensing
Artificial intelligence is fundamentally transforming Italy's smart poles from passive illumination into responsive urban assets. An Italian company based in northern Italy has developed and patented an AI-based light control system that transforms every street lamp into a smart-sensing device by anonymously classifying the surrounding soundscape. The RESONANCE project in Beinasco deploys adaptive LED smart poles connected through an IoT network, enabling real-time brightness adjustments based on traffic and weather conditions.

Italy Smart Pole Software Market by Component
• Hardware forms the physical foundation of Italy's smart pole infrastructure, encompassing LED lighting lamps, durable pole brackets, communication devices, and controllers. Brescia's City Plug Lamp project features eight poles with high-efficiency LED lights and 16 EV charging points. The RESONANCE project retrofits existing lampposts with dimmable LEDs, air quality sensors, noise monitors, traffic counters, and EV chargers.
• Software platforms are rapidly emerging as the strategic differentiator, enabling centralized management, real-time monitoring, and predictive maintenance. The RESONANCE project's IoT network enables dynamic brightness adjustments and data-driven traffic and environmental management. Piedmont Region has offered to connect Beinasco with similar regional initiatives, enabling comparisons and access to a wider environmental data pool.
• The service segment encompasses installation, maintenance, data analytics, and cybersecurity management. Enel X has expressed readiness to leverage existing network infrastructure for intelligent pole installation. A dedicated working group between the Municipality of Beinasco, InBlenda engineering firm, and Enel X will define the next steps for implementing pilot actions.

Italy Smart Pole Software Market by Installation Type
• New installations are deployed in greenfield developments, major infrastructure projects, and urban renewal zones. Brescia's City Plug Lamp project represents new installation, with eight poles strategically positioned near the Brescia Due metro station. The Metropolitan City of Venice has invested €2.5 million to modernise and remotely control 45 traffic light systems along its provincial road network.
• Retrofit installations offer cost-effective pathways to smart pole adoption, converting existing streetlight infrastructure without new foundations. The RESONANCE project focuses on retrofitting existing lampposts with sensors, transforming traditional lighting into multifunctional smart infrastructure. Livorno completed retrofitting work along Via Montebello in August 2025, replacing existing fixtures with high-efficiency LED technology.

Italy Smart Pole Software Market by Application
Smart transportation leads Italian smart pole applications, with adaptive lighting improving safety and energy efficiency. The Metropolitan City of Venice's €2.5 million project modernises 45 traffic light systems along the provincial road network through a centralised remote control system. The RESONANCE project explores integrating smart traffic light systems that adapt to vehicle flows.
• Public spaces benefit from smart poles providing environmental monitoring, lighting, and safety services. Beinasco's RESONANCE project aims to improve air quality and reduce noise pollution through distributed environmental sensors. Monza's lighting upgrade achieved a 3.40% failure rate in 2025, demonstrating the reliability improvements possible with intelligent infrastructure.
• Industrial applications at railways and harbours leverage smart poles for logistics optimisation and security. The EIB-INWIT financing supports improved mobile connectivity in locations including underground lines and motorway tunnels. INWIT's micro-grid infrastructure investments include outdoor small cells suitable for deployment on smart poles in transport corridors.
• Corporate campuses and parking lots deploy smart poles for security surveillance, occupancy monitoring, and EV charging. Brescia's City Plug Lamp project is located in a parking lot adjacent to the Brescia Due metro station. The five-year pilot project, valued at €100,000, demonstrates the commercial viability of integrating EV charging with public lighting infrastructure.
